Associated Alcohols & Breweries Ltd. Closes Trading Window from Jan 1, 2026

Associated Alcohols & Breweries Limited has announced the closure of its trading window for dealing in the company's securities. The window will be closed from January 1, 2026, and will remain shut until 48 hours after the declaration of the financial results for the quarter ending December 31, 2025. During this period, Directors, Promoters, Promoter Group, Key Managerial Personnel (KMP), Designated Persons, and their immediate relatives are advised not to engage in any transactions involving the company's shares, either directly or indirectly. The company will inform the stock exchanges in due course about the date of the Board of Directors' meeting to approve the Unaudited Financial Results (UFR) for the quarter ended December 31, 2025.
